Vienotais resursu meklētājs identificē konkrētu resursu, pakalpojumu vai objektu tīklā. URL virknes sastāv no trim daļām: protokola apzīmējuma, saimniekdatora nosaukuma vai adreses un resursa atrašanās vietas.
URL protokola apakšvirknes
URL apakšvirknes ir atdalītas ar speciālajām rakstzīmēm šādi:
protokols:// saimniekdators / atrašanās vieta
Protokola apakšvirkne nosaka tīkla protokolu, lai piekļūtu resursam. Šīs virknes ir īsi nosaukumi, kam seko trīs rakstzīmes :. Tipiski URL protokoli ietver HTTP (https://), FTP (ftp://) un e-pastu (mailto://).
Bottom Line
Resursdatora apakšvirkne identificē mērķa datoru vai citu tīkla ierīci. Saimniekdatora avots ir standarta interneta datu bāzes, piemēram, DNS, un tie var būt vārdi vai IP adreses. Daudzu vietņu saimniekdatoru nosaukumi attiecas ne tikai uz vienu datoru, bet drīzāk uz serveru grupām.
URL atrašanās vietas apakšvirknes
Atrašanās vietas apakšvirkne satur ceļu uz vienu konkrētu tīkla resursu resursdatorā. Resursi parasti atrodas resursdatora direktorijā vai mapē. Piemēram, vietnē var būt tāds resurss kā /2016/September/word-of-the-day-04.htm, lai sakārtotu saturu pēc datumiem.
Ja atrašanās vietas elements ir tukša saīsne, piemēram, URL https://example.com, URL parasti norāda uz saimniekdatora saknes direktoriju (apzīmē ar viena slīpsvītra) un bieži vien sākumlapa (piemēram, index.htm).
Absolūtie un relatīvie URL
Pilnus URL, kuros ir visas trīs apakšvirknes, sauc par absolūtajiem URL. Dažos gadījumos vietrāži URL var norādīt tikai vienu atrašanās vietas elementu. Tos sauc par relatīvajiem URL. Tīmekļa serveri izmanto relatīvos vietrāžus URL, lai izvairītos no stingri kodētu atrašanās vietas elementu, kas var tikt mainīti.
Sekojot iepriekš minētajam piemēram, tīmekļa lapas tajā pašā serverī, kas ir saistītas ar to, var kodēt relatīvo URL šādi:
Tā izmanto relatīvo URL, nevis ekvivalento absolūto URL:
Tas izmanto servera pieņēmumu, ka trūkst protokola un resursdatora informācijas. Relatīvie URL darbojas tikai tad, ja ir izveidota resursdatora un protokola informācija.
URL saīsināšana
Standarta vietrāži URL mūsdienu vietnēs parasti ir garas teksta virknes. Tā kā garu vietrāžu URL kopīgošana pakalpojumā Twitter un citās sociālo mediju vietnēs ir apgrūtinoša, vairāki uzņēmumi izveidoja tiešsaistes tulkotājus, kas pārvērš pilnu (absolūto) URL īsākā URL, kas īpaši paredzēts lietošanai savos sociālajos tīklos. Populāri šāda veida URL saīsinātāji ir t.co (izmanto ar Twitter) un lnkd.in (izmanto ar LinkedIn).
Citi URL saīsināšanas pakalpojumi, piemēram, bit.ly un goo.gl darbojas visā internetā, nevis tikai ar noteiktām sociālo mediju vietnēm.
Daži URL saīsināšanas pakalpojumi ne tikai piedāvā vienkāršāku veidu, kā koplietot saites ar citiem, bet arī piedāvā klikšķu statistiku. Daži arī nodrošina aizsardzību pret ļaunprātīgu izmantošanu, pārbaudot URL atrašanās vietu pret aizdomīgu domēnu sarakstu.